Fall Ecommerce Holiday Trends and Digital Payment Evolution: Gearing Up for 2023 and Beyond

The global ecommerce landscape is in a state of dynamic evolution, with every holiday season ushering in fresh trends and innovative strategies. As the fall of 2023 beckons, businesses are preparing to cater to a new wave of consumer behavior and digital payment preferences. This article delves into the heart of holiday ecommerce shopping trends and the transformation in the digital payment domain for the upcoming festive season.

1. Early Bird Shopping

Based on current holiday ecommerce shopping trends, consumers are initiating their holiday purchases earlier than the traditional timeline. The objective? To capitalize on early-bird discounts, ensure timely delivery, and dodge the last-minute shopping frenzy that has often led to out-of-stock disappointments in the past.

2. The Emergence of Niche Ecommerce Ventures

As the ecommerce realm broadens, there's a visible surge in niche ecommerce business ideas. Whether it's platforms exclusively dealing in handcrafted festive decor, bespoke holiday gift boxes, or curated holiday travel packages, these specialized businesses offer consumers a more tailored shopping experience, setting themselves apart in the vast online market.

3. AI and AR Steer the Shopping Experience

Artificial Intelligence and Augmented Reality are no longer futuristic concepts but integral aspects of the online shopping journey. Virtual trial rooms, chatbots offering gift suggestions, and AR-driven product demos are enhancing the shopping experience, merging the tactile satisfaction of physical shopping with online convenience.

4. Revamping the Payment Gateway: The Digital Payments Trends

  • Cryptocurrency: More retailers are now opening up to the idea of accepting cryptocurrency as a legitimate payment method, with Bitcoin and Ethereum leading the charge.
  •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L): A flexible payment approach, BNPL caters to those who prefer staggering their payments over a period, a particularly beneficial option during the heavy-spending holiday season.
  • Contactless Payments: In a post-pandemic world, the emphasis on touch-free transactions remains high. NFC-driven payments, QR codes, and mobile wallets are continually gaining traction.

5. Emphasizing Sustainability

Eco-conscious shopping is no fleeting trend. 2023 witnesses a more informed shopper base keen on supporting brands that prioritize sustainable practices. Be it through eco-friendly packaging, carbon-neutral shipping, or products that promote zero waste, the green shift in ecommerce is palpable.

6. Enhanced Security in Digital Transactions

With the surge in online shopping comes the responsibility of ensuring a secure transaction environment. Multi-factor authentication, biometric scans, and advanced encryption techniques are standardizing, offering consumers peace of mind with every purchase.
